SAFETY INFORMATION
This printer is a page printer which operates by means of a laser. There is no possibility of danger from the laser, provided the printer is operated according to the instructions in this manual provided. Since radiation emitted by the laser is completely confined within protective housings, the laser beam camot escape from the machine during any phase of user operation.
For United States Users;
[Laser Safety] This printer is certified as a Class 1 Laser product under the U.S. Department of Health and Human Services (DHHS) Radiation Performance Standard according to the Radiation Control for Health and Safety Act of 1968. This means that the printer does not produce hazardous laser radiation. [CDRH Regulations] The Center for Devices and Radiological Health (CDRH) of the U.S. Food and Drug Administration implemented regulations for laser products on August 2,1976. Compliance is mandatory for products marketed in the United States. The label shown below indicates compliance with the CDRH regulations and must reattached to laser products marketed in the United States. WARNING: Use of controls, adjustments or performance of procedures other than those specified in this manual may result in hazardous radiation exposure, [Internal Laser Radiation] Maximum Radiation Power: Wave Length: 5.7x 104(W) 780 nm ,,-
This is a Class IIIb Laser Diode Assay that has an invisible laser beam. The print head unit is NOT A FIELD SERVICE ITEM. Therefore, the print head unit should not be opened under any circumstances.

1.1 FEATURES
The Epson @ EpL.5600 and the ActionLaser TM 1600 are non-impa~ page pMterS that ~rnbine a semi-conductor laser with electro-photographic technology. These printem are small and lighc and feature high-speed, high-resolution printing. Maintenance is very easy as a result of various built-in diagnostic functions. The main features are: No ozone Printing speed -- 6 ppm (pages per minute) Resolution -- 600/300 dpi (dots per inch) Light weight -- about 10 kg (22 lb.) Small footprint Easy maintenance HP@ LaserJet@ 4 emulation mode 45 built-in scalable fonts (35 Intellifonts and 10 TrueType fonts) ~/p 2'" emulation High-performance controller (the controller's CPU is a 17.6 MHz SPARKlite (MB86930)) Bi Resolution Improvement Technology (BiRITech) refines the print quality by eliminating jagged edges from images and characters on 600 dpi and 300 dpi printing. Optional EPSONScript Level 2 (Postscript" compatible) module EPSON Miao Gray Technology (EMGTech), which is available when using EPSONSaipt Level 2 mode, refines gray scale printing to be comparable to printing on a 1200-dpi printer Small and low-cost optional LocalTalkTM interface module 2 MB standard RAM and up to 64 MB RAM wi'h the addition of optional SIMMS Bidirectional parallel interface High-speed serial communication rate of 57.6K bps High-speed parallel communication rate of approximately 400 KB/second A multi-user, multi-emulation mode IES (Intelligent Emulation Switch) allows switching between EPSONScript mode and another mode SPL (Shared Printer Language) enables switching of the printer mode by command Figure 1-1 shows an exterior view of the EPL-5600 and ActionLaser 1600.

Handshaking
When the vacant area for data in the input buffer drops to 256 bytes, the printer outputs an X-OFF code or sets the DTR signal level to LOW, indicating that the printer cannot receive more data. Once the vacant area for data in the buffer recovers to 512 bytes, the printer outputs an X-ON code or sets the DTR flag to HIGH, indicating that the printer is again ready to receive data.
Protocol
There are two types of protocols, as listed below, and each of them can be designated by SelecType independently. 9 DTR/DSR protocol SelecType is used to execute the DTR/DSR control protocol. l%e DTR signal is set to HIGH when the printer is ready to receive data, and to LOW when conditions indicate an error or that the receiving buffer is full. When the error is cleared and the printer returns to on-line mode, the signal returns to HIGH. When SelecType is used to set the DTR control OFF, DTR is always set HIGH. The printer transmits TXD only when DSR is at the HIGH level (DSR is always considered HIGH when the SelecType setting for DSR is OFF). X-ON/X~FF transmission is independent of the DSR state. 9 X-ON/X-OFF (DC1/DC3) protocol SelecType is used to execute the X-ON/X-Ow protocol. The X-OFF (DC3) code is output if status indicates an error, and the printer warns the host to stop data transmission within 128 characters. No further X-OFF codes are sent in response to additional data received from the host after the X-OFF code has been sent once. The X-ON (DCl) code is output after all conditions given in the error are cleared. When the remaining capacity of the receive buffer reaches 256 characters, X-OFF (DC3) is output once. It is sent only once, even if there are multiple errors. The printer goes on line automatically at power on, and outputs an X-ON code. Transmission of X~N/X-OFF codes can be defined by SelecType.

1.4.3 Service Mode
This printer has four service modes as follows:
s Hexadecimal Dump Mode s Language Setting Mode s Factory Service Mode s EEPROM Format
1.4.3.1 Hexadecimal Dump Mode The hexadecimal dump mode is a useful tool in trouble shooting data control problems. To enter hexadecimal dump mode, turn on the printer while holding down the ON LINE button until "HEX DUMP MODE" is displayed.
1.4.3.2 Language Setting Mode The language setting mode allows the user to specify a language for panel displays and the status
sheet. To enter language setting mode, turn on the printer while holding down the MENU button until "CONFIG LANGUAGE" is displayed. The options are changed by pressing the ~ and ~ buttons and are set by pressing the ENTER button. Available options areas follows: ENGLISH, FRAN~AIS, DEUTCH, ITALIANO, Espatiol, SVENSKA, DANSK, NEDERL, SUOMI, PORTUGUI%

1.4.6 Emulation Mode Switch Function
This section describes the emulation mode switch function.
1.4.6.1 Emulation Switch by SPL
The two types of emulation switch functions described below are available on this printer. Together they are referred to as SPL (Shared Printer Language).
EJL: EPSON Job Language
This is EPSON's original language system. It is able to skip among various destinations, as shown in Figure 1-12.
PJL: Printer Job Language
This is HP's original language, which is available with the LaserJet 4 printer. It is able to skip among various destinations, as shown in Figure 1-12. The precise specifications for this language are based on the HP LaserJet 4. The figure below shows three types of mode switching. Neither EJL nor PJL switches the mode directly. They first exit the current mode and return to EJL or PJL. Then they enter another mode. W4

1.4.7 Bi Resolution improvement Technology
The EPL-5600/ActionLaser 1600 printers have BiRiTech @i Resolution Improvement t Technology), which is designed to improve print quality at 6MI dpi and 300 dpi. By this method, the dot map data extracted from the image data is reassembled to impmve print data. The main improvement of this technique is in eliminating "jaggies" in diagoml lines. It is most effective when the dot map data fits the development characteristics of the printer mecbnism well. his therefore nemssary to set appropriate values in SelecType.

BiRITech is not as effective for printing a mesh pattern or gray scale. In such cases, BiRITech must be set to OFF. (The default setting is MEDIUM.) Since the BiRITech effect depends on the toner condition, it should be adjusted when the imaging cartridge is replaced or after the imaging cartridge is used for a long time.
The following settings are available in SelecType Level for RITech: DARK, MEDIUM, LIGHT, OFF. When the toner density of area A is almost the same as that of area B (as shown in the figure below), the RITech setting is at its optimum setting. In other words, the optimum setting is achieved when it is difficult to distinguish the shape of area A from that of B. A

1.4.8 Optional Memory
If you have difficulty printing complex, graphics-intensive pages or if you regularly use downloaded fonts, you may need to install the optional SIMM sets on this printer's controller board. The printer's controller board comes with 2.0 MB of RAM installed. By installing additional SIMMS, you can increase the printer's memory to a total of 64 MB, including the resident memory. EPSON supplies several types of memory option (SIMM). Other SIMMS can be purchased from other vendors. Be sure the SIMM meets the requirements listed below.
s 72-pin type s Capacity is one of the following: 1,2,4,8,16,32 MB s Access speed is less than 70 ns. s With-in the following dimensional size
36 mm (Height) x 108 mm (Width) x 10 mm (Depth)
